The choice of sealing technology depends entirely on the tube material. For plastic and laminated tubes, you must select a machine equipped with Hot Air Sealing or Ultrasonic Sealing technology to ensure a molecular bond. For aluminum tubes, a Mechanical Folding (Crimping) system is required, often involving double, triple, or saddle folds. If your production line handles both, look for interchangeable sealing heads to maximize equipment versatility.
To ensure efficiency, prioritize machines with a PLC Control System (such as Siemens or Delta) and a Touch Screen Interface for easy parameter adjustment. Look for a production capacity of 30-60 tubes per minute for medium-scale operations. Additionally, ensure the machine features Automatic Tube Loading and Photoelectric Registration, which aligns the tube's artwork precisely before sealing to maintain brand aesthetics.

A high-quality seal is determined by precise temperature control (within ±1°C) and adjustable sealing pressure. Request a pressure leak test report from the supplier. For aesthetic and functional excellence, ensure the machine includes a Trimming Unit to remove excess plastic and a Coding Embosser to stamp batch numbers and expiry dates directly into the seal area.
